Whiskey lactone Usage And Synthesis


Chemical Properties

Whiskey Lactone is found as its cis- and trans-isomers in whiskey and in oakwood volatiles; the cis-isomer is the more important in sensory terms. It is a clear, almost colorless liquid with an intense, warm, sweet, coumarin-like odor.
A cis–trans mixture can be prepared by radical addition reaction of pentanal with crotonic acid followed by reductive cyclization of the resulting ??-oxo acid with sodium boron hydride/sulfuric acid . It is used in aroma compositions, for example, for beverages.

Aroma threshold values

80% of a taste panel found whiskey lactone intolerable at 160 ppm

Taste threshold values

Taste characteristics at 0.5 ppm: woody, coumarinic, coconut, lactonic, creamy and nutty with a toasted nuance.
